What is a Solutions Architect
IT

softgvld / March 26, 2026

It is an idealized solution that is not just scalable but also secure and high-performing. A solution architect acts as a bridge between vision and execution. In the world of fast-evolving technology, many businesses can’t afford misaligned systems, costly rework, or performance bottlenecks. 

Though this evolving technology is known as a Solutions Architect which ensures that every technical choice, whether it’s about building an infrastructure or integration of the third-party APIs, is in line with business objectives along with laying the groundwork for smooth development and long-term success. What precisely does this position entail and why has it grown to be so important in contemporary software development?

Here we have a detailed blog that exposes what is solutions architect along with the roles and responsibilities of the solution architect in the development of any software solution. Let’s unpack it together.

Decoding the Role of Solution Architect

We have noticed two key roles of solution architect in the digital landscape that have shaped how systems are designed and implemented, these roles are known as: Enterprise Architect, and Technical Architect. 

Enterprise Architect

Enterprise Architects take a holistic view of the entire organization while effectively analyzing business entities, systems, relationships and external ecosystems to design solutions that address critical business challenges. A strategic role is played by overseeing architecture decisions, assigning tasks to specialists and ensuring a streamlined application lifecycle. The primary focus is to align technology with business goals along with selecting the most effective tools and platforms for each use case.

Technical Architect

Technical Architects provide hands-on guidance and leadership to development teams who are open to taking responsibility for engineering solutions, designing software architecture and overseeing technology implementation. They play a critical role in defining technical standards, best practice and frameworks while ensuring consistency and quality throughout the project while working closely with developers to bring the architecture to life.

Till now, we’ve seen how a Solutions Architect forms an invisible bridge and fills in the gap between business goals and technical execution while ensuring products are delivered on time, within budget and built to solve real challenges. But what does this role look like regularly? Let’s take a closer look at the key responsibilities that define solution architect day-to-day work.

Also Read: Predictive Analytics in Software Development

Defining the Core Pillars of the Solution Architect’s Role

Core Pillars of the Solution Architect

  • Craft Solutions Aligned with Your Business Goals

Businesses typically have integration facilities, operating systems, and information context. Any new system that is implemented must fit into the existing business environment, according to a solutions architect. He or she understands how the various components of the business model function together and how to create a solution that best fits this combination of architecture, operations, and operating system.

  • Deliver Solutions That Meet Every Stakeholder Need

Meeting the needs and requirements of stakeholders, whether technical or non-technical, is one of the solution architect tasks that are primarily considered. This ensures that all viewpoints are taken into account throughout the project. By informing stakeholders about the product’s development, budget, and progress, they also perform a crucial communication role. 

  • Navigate Project Constraints with Confidence

With the deeper well of opportunities, there are some set of limitations or restrictions that come along with the software, they can be: 

  1. scope
  2. technology
  3. quality
  4. time
  5. cost
  6. unanticipated risks
  7. resources

These components have their own set of limits even though they are “constraints.” To handle these problems well within the company objectives, the solution architect must comprehend them, assess their importance, and make management and technical judgments.

  • Choose the Right Technology Stack for Success

A crucial responsibility of a Solutions Architect is selecting the most suitable technologies for product development which includes tools, platforms, APIs and programming languages. Furthermore, they evaluate and compare different approaches while determining the best fit for each project among multiple options. This decision is driven by in-depth technical analysis while ensuring the chosen technology stack aligns with the project’s requirements and helps conquer long-term goals.

  • Deliver Quality Through Non-Functional Excellence

Beyond core functionality, every software project must meet a range of non-functional requirements as well as that of the system, how it performs and operates, such as performance, security, scalability, usability, and maintainability. 

A solutions architect is responsible for ensuring these critical aspects are built into the product by guiding development teams and aligning engineering efforts with these standards. By giving the broad scope of this role,  it’s clear that solution architects need a diverse and well-rounded skill set, which is something we’ll explore next.

Core Components That Power Solution Architecture

By performing several solution architect roles and responsibilities, the system ensures efficiency, scalability, and long-term success by viewing a solution as an organized framework composed of interrelated parts that work together to achieve a specific result.

People: Customers or end consumers of the business’s goods or services; members of the organization’s team who will apply and/or utilize the solution; and outside partners who will assist with new procedures. Describe their responsibilities, abilities, and skills.

Organization: The organization’s structure and operations, including its partner organizations, divisions and teams, and management hierarchy.

Processes: Any actions taken to further the objectives and mission of the organization. This covers all business activities, as well as the rules and procedures that accompany them.

Information: Comprising the information gathered from partners and users (input) as well as the reports and business intelligence derived from it (output). Records of business transactions as well.

Technology: Any technological tools and systems that the company makes use of, such as cloud platforms, manufacturing capabilities, Internet of Things (IoT), computer hardware, software, and communications.

Must-Have Skills for Modern Solution Architects

Skills for Modern Solution Architects

As you can expect, there are a wide range of roles and duties that address what solution architects perform. They would need to have the best skill sets in order to meet them. Next, let’s investigate those abilities. 

Technical Expertise

A solutions architect combines a strategic vision with in-depth knowledge of several IT fields. Instead of focusing solely on systems, they take a step back to understand the bigger picture by looking at how processes connect and produce value. Additionally, they transform vision into solutions that are scalable and ensure that every decision is consistent with the company’s overall strategy and long-term performance while acting as a crucial link between business objectives and technical implementation. Some of the technical expertise are mentioned that define solution architect roles and responsibilities

  • OS and Computer Systems
  • Software architecture design
  • Infrastructure design
  • Creation of web platforms
  • Cloud computing
  • Product management
  • Database management
  • Hardware management
  • DevOps practices
  • Analytical skills
  • System and data security

Project Management

Solutions architects are liable for fulfilling deadlines and efficiently allocating resources, even though they are not directly in charge of project development. Within the project timeframe, they must carefully consider all available solutions, choosing the one that supports company objectives and eliminating the others. They also keep an eye on the future, making sure the software is flexible, scalable, and ready for new developments.

Risk Management

Solutions architects must evaluate the possible hazards and their effects in addition to the technical and financial ramifications of their suggested solutions. Since efficient risk management has become a crucial duty in today’s fast-paced, agile businesses, they must have strong risk mitigation methods in place. Gaining proficiency in this area allows them to support the “fail-fast” mentality of contemporary companies, guaranteeing resilient and creative solutions.

Superior Communication

Although the skills mentioned above are essential, the solutions architects will also need to be skilled communicators. They will have to deal with developers, managers, project teams, software architects, and various stakeholders on a daily basis. They must be able to communicate the project’s vision and updates in a way that each individual stakeholder can comprehend and react to for this degree of intensive cooperation.

Key Benefits of Solution Architecture for Your Business

Even after gaining a thorough understanding of the tasks and responsibilities of a solution architect, are you still unsure if it is essential for your company? Here are five noteworthy advantages that demonstrate its value.

Custom-Built Solutions Designed for Your Business

The purpose of solution architecture is to mitigate or meet particular organizational needs. Before suggesting a custom solution that takes into account all functional and non-functional requirements as well as your available resources, the solution architect carefully examines how your company operates. Additionally, the solution must be compatible with your enterprise environment so that you may use it right away with few integration problems.

Driving Business Growth Through Technology Alignment

A particular business need is always the foundation of solution architecture. Although this is frequently the motivation behind the project, it’s not always about solving an issue. The “need” of your company might also be a goal, like becoming a leader in your sector or increasing revenues by 20%. The solution architect will create a plan that can be converted into workable IT solutions that support your goal and realize your vision.

Smarter Budgeting for Better Business Outcomes

Your solution architect will provide you with a detailed explanation of the cost and resources required to complete the task, whether it involves new software or a full digital transformation. As a result, you’ll be able to assign resources to the appropriate teams and create more precise project budgets.

Unlocking Maximum ROI Through Smart Solutions

When designing a solution, the solution architect will look for technology that provides optimal performance and the highest value for your company. Solution architects strive to ensure the best potential return on investment by streamlining your company operations without going over budget. 

Future-Proof Your Business for Long-Term Success

Solution architects are knowledgeable about the most recent developments in SA and EA. They are able to implement a technical solution that satisfies your needs both now and in the future. This lays the groundwork for adaptable and scalable solutions that will support long-term expansion.

How Solution Architecture Works: Key Examples

Solution architecture spans a wide range of architectural disciplines, all operating under the broader umbrella of enterprise architecture. While experts may differ in how they define its exact scope, it is most commonly focused on the core layers that directly shape how solutions are designed, integrated, and delivered—making it a critical driver of practical, business-aligned technology outcomes.

  • Business Architecture

Aligning business strategies with technology is the main goal of business solution architecture. The solution architect specifies the necessary procedures and equipment as well as the business goals. They usually make use of a business capability map, which provides an overview of the company’s operations and explains how the appropriate solution would improve business results.

  • System Architecture

The structural design of IT systems that automate procedures is the focus of system architecture, a subset of SA. This covers the interface design as well as the selection of services, layers, and components. Conceptual models are used by solution architects to decide how each component should be positioned and behave.

  • Information Security Architecture

The solution architect will incorporate information security into the solution, whether you’re replacing the entire IT system or incorporating a new tool. They will provide you advice on the newest technology and ensure that it complies with your current security regulations. Additionally, they will record how the solution will adhere to industry standards.

Drive Meaningful Transformation with Our Powerful Solutions

The purpose of a solution architect is to implement the innovative technological framework that not only fulfills the organization’s current needs but also prepares it for long-term success. While achieving this requires careful planning and effort, the process becomes far more manageable with the right tools in place. Software Development Company comes with the support within the architecture landscape of multiple enterprises which includes a solution architect by offering more than just standard capabilities. 

Simple answer to the concerns about what a solutions architect does. Well, it empowers organizations to successfully navigate strategic initiatives like digital transformation through expert guidance, craft product configuration while keeping proven industry practices in consideration. 

Moreover, by eliminating the gaps between functions of IT and businesses, we play a vital role in understanding how people, processes, technology and data interconnect, and help businesses make an informed decision at the right time.

Conclusion

A Solutions Architect plays a pivotal role in transforming business vision into practical and future-ready digital solutions. They ensure that every technical decision aligns with organizational goals, minimizes risks and maximizes performance. As businesses continue to evolve in an increasingly digital landscape, the importance of solution architecture only grows by making it an essential function for organizations across several industries aiming to innovate and stay competitive.

Frequently Asked Questions

Q: What is a Solutions Architect in software development?

A Solutions Architect is a professional who designs and manages the overall technical solution of a project, ensuring it aligns with business goals, technical requirements, and long-term scalability.

Q: What are the main responsibilities of a Solutions Architect?

Their key responsibilities include defining system architecture, selecting the technology stack, managing project constraints, ensuring stakeholder alignment, and maintaining both functional and non-functional requirements.

Q: How is a Solutions Architect different from a Technical Architect?

A Solutions Architect focuses on the overall business solution and system design, while a Technical Architect is more focused on the technical implementation, coding standards, and engineering details.

Q: Why is Solution Architecture important for businesses?

Solution Architecture ensures that technology solutions are scalable, cost-effective, secure, and aligned with business objectives, helping businesses reduce risks and improve ROI.

Q: What skills are required to become a successful Solutions Architect?

Key skills include system design, cloud computing, software architecture, project management, risk management, problem-solving, and strong communication abilities.